If you stay at a weight that is healthy you will be unlikely to suffer from GERD. Your esophageal sphincter relaxes whenever excess body fat accumulates, especially on your midsection. Your body can restrict the acid flow much better if you are at a healthy weight.

It pays to remain in an upright while you eat and for two or three hours following a meal. Lying down directly after a meal can force acid to travel up your esophagus with much greater ease. Your esophagus will feel better by standing up on your feet.

Take off the extra weight. Too much weight on your stomach can seriously aggravate reflux symptoms. The additional fat around the stomach increases pressure put on the stomach, increasing the chances of acid reflux. Losing a small amount of weight can offer a lot of relief.

Chew on cinnamon flavored gum after meals. The chewing causes more saliva production. The acid can be neutralized by your saliva. Chewing gum also causes a person to swallow more often, which helps to clear the esophagus of excess acid. You may find fruit flavored gum if you prefer that. Mint gums can relax the esophagus’s sphincter and worsen symptoms.

Don’t drink alcohol if you have acid reflux. Any alcohol, whether from wine, beer, or spirits, can weaken the muscles of the esophagus, leading to reflux. You can have the occasional drink, however try to avoid it in excess if you want to avoid acid reflux.
